Linux如何开启终端颜色设置? (linux开启颜色设置吗)
Linux作为一个强大的操作系统,在开发和运维领域有着广泛的应用。在使用Linux时,我们经常需要通过终端来操作系统。而在终端操作时,我们可以通过颜色设置来区分不同的输出信息,提高可读性。那么如何在Linux系统中开启终端颜色设置呢?接下来,我们将为您提供详细的教程。
一、检查终端是否支持颜色
在开启终端颜色设置之前,我们需要先检查终端是否支持颜色。使用如下命令:
“`bash
echo -e “\033[01;31mColor Test\033[0m”
“`
运行后,如果输出为红色,则说明您的终端支持颜色。否则,则需要考虑更换终端或者升级终端软件。
二、在.bashrc文件中配置颜色
1.打开.bashrc文件。该文件在用户的主目录下。使用如下命令:
“`bash
vi ~/.bashrc
“`
2.找到以下两行内容:
“`bash
#force_color_prompt=yes
“`
去掉注释,变为:
“`bash
force_color_prompt=yes
“`
然后将其下方的内容:
“`bash
if [ -n “$force_color_prompt” ]; then
if [ -x /usr/bin/tput ] && tput setaf 1 >&/dev/null; then
PS1=’${debian_chroot:+($debian_chroot)}\[\033[01;32m\]\u@\h\[\033[00m\]:\[\033[01;34m\]\w\[\033[00m\]\$ ‘
else
PS1=’${debian_chroot:+($debian_chroot)}\u@\h:\w\$ ‘
fi
else
PS1=’${debian_chroot:+($debian_chroot)}\u@\h:\w\$ ‘
fi
“`
替换为以下内容:
“`bash
if [ $color_prompt = yes ]; then
PS1=’${debian_chroot:+($debian_chroot)}\[\033[01;32m\]\u@\h\[\033[00m\]:\[\033[01;34m\]\w\[\033[00m\]\$ ‘
else
PS1=’${debian_chroot:+($debian_chroot)}\u@\h:\w\$ ‘
fi
“`
3.按下ESC键,输入:wq保存文件,并且退出。
4.再次打开终端,您现在应该能够看到一个自定义的彩色提示符。这意味着您已经成功开启了终端颜色设置。
三、使用别名为输出信息添加颜色
1.在.bashrc文件中新增一个别名。使用如下命令:
“`bash
alias dir=’ls -l –color=auto’
“`
这将使用绿色作为dir命令的输出信息颜色。
2.按下ESC键,输入:wq保存文件,并且退出。
3.输入dir命令,您将看到绿色的输出信息。
四、使用CoLiPu命令行工具自定义配色方案
1.首先需要安装CoLiPu命令行工具。使用如下命令:
“`bash
sudo apt-get install colipu
“`
2.启动CoLiPu。使用如下命令:
“`bash
colipu
“`
3.在CoLiPu窗口中,您将看到预定义的配色方案。选择任意一个方案并输入它的序号。
4.在选择配色方案后,您可以对所有元素(前景、背景、鼠标文本等)进行自定义设置。您还可以导出/导入配色方案。
5.设置完毕后,按下ESC键并输入:wq保存更改。
6.重新打开终端,您将看到新的配色方案已经生效。
到此为止,我们已经介绍了三种在Linux系统中开启终端颜色设置的方法。现在您可以通过检查终端是否支持颜色、在.bashrc文件配置颜色以及使用别名和CoLiPu命令行工具自定义配色方案来提高您对终端输出信息的可读性。希望这些方法对您有所帮助!